I purchased two Tunigy Nano-Tech 4500 5 cell batteries. The balance plug is so much bigger that it won't fit into my balance board. Anyone out there know what to do?????? I guess that may be what I get for trying to save some money, thanks for any help.

It's bigger because it's made for "standard" asian LiPo 5 cell balance chargers/adapters.
The Electrifly stuff conforms to this type of plug.
What you had may have been targetted to other formats.
What balance board/charger do you have?
I'll bet you can use an Electrifly 5S adapter with it just fine.
